,如果您想修改杰奇建站的默认缓存时间,您可以:,登录到杰奇建站的管理后台;,查找管理缓存或相关设置的部分;,按照提示进行操作,调整缓存时间的值;,保存更改并重新加载网站以查看效果。,更改缓存设置可能会影响到网站的加载速度和性能,所以请确保您了解所做的更改以及其潜在影响,如果可能的话,在进行更改之前备份您的数据,并在进行更改后进行全面测试,以确保一切正常运行。
在现代Web开发中,服务器的响应速度和效率对于用户体验至关重要,缓存机制是提高服务器性能的关键技术之一,许多网站在使用缓存时,默认的缓存时间可能并不适用于所有场景,有时我们需要根据具体需求调整这些设置以提高网站的性能或解决特定的问题,本文将介绍如何在杰奇建站系统中修改默认缓存时间。
理解缓存机制
要修改默认缓存时间,首先需要深入理解HTTP缓存的工作原理,HTTP缓存是通过HTTP响应头中的Cache-Control和Expires字段来控制的。Cache-Control允许服务器指定资源的缓存策略,如缓存时间、是否必须从服务器重新获取资源等。Expires字段则给出了资源过期时间的日期和时间。
杰奇建站中的缓存设置
在杰奇建站系统中,这些HTTP头部字段通常会在服务器配置文件或控制面板中设置,具体路径可能因版本或安装方式的不同而有所差异,但一般情况下,可以在以下几个位置找到相关设置:
-
服务器配置文件:对于使用IIS或Nginx等服务器的网站,缓存设置通常在相应的配置文件中,在Nginx中,可以通过
add_header指令来设置Cache-Control和Expires字段。 -
PHP配置文件:如果网站使用PHP作为后端语言,还可以在
php.ini文件中设置这些头部字段,通过在文件末尾添加如下代码,可以临时或永久地修改默认的缓存时间:header("Cache-Control: max-age=3600"); // 设置缓存时间为1小时 header("Expires: " . gmdate("D, d M Y H:i:s", time() + 3600) . " GMT"); -
建站控制面板:许多建站系统提供了图形化的控制面板,用户可以通过它轻松管理网站的各项设置,包括缓存时间,在控制面板中找到相关选项,并根据提示进行操作即可。
修改默认缓存时间的注意事项
在修改默认缓存时间时,需要注意以下几点:
-
缓存时间过长可能导致资源过期,影响网站正常使用,应根据实际情况合理设置缓存时间,避免过长或过短。
-
修改缓存时间可能会影响网站的SEO排名,搜索引擎爬虫在抓取网站内容时,会根据
Expires或Cache-Control字段来判断资源是否新鲜,频繁修改可能导致搜索引擎不更新旧的页面内容,从而影响排名。 -
不同浏览器和客户端可能对缓存的处理方式有所不同,为确保兼容性,建议进行充分的测试,并在必要时调整代码逻辑以适应不同的客户端环境。
通过理解HTTP缓存机制并正确设置杰奇建站中的相关参数,可以有效提升网站的性能,修改默认缓存时间需要谨慎操作,并充分测试以确保网站的稳定性和兼容性,希望本文的介绍能对广大网站开发者有所帮助,让大家能够更加高效地管理和优化自己的网站。